The Career Certificate provides basic skills in technical courses that prepare students for entry-level jobs. Below are the requirements for Career Certificate programs:

• Complete all specific certificate requirements. All courses
should be numbered 100 or above except in continuing
education certificate programs.
• Complete at least seven semester hours or one-third of
the semester hours for the certificate at Morton College.
• Attend the College in the semester in which the certificate
is completed.
• File a Petition for Graduation form with the Office of
Admissions and Records.
